What is an environmental services assistant?

Environmental Services Assistants are professionals responsible for maintaining cleanliness, sanitation, and a safe environment in facilities such as hospitals, schools, and office buildings. Their duties often include c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, managing waste disposal, and ensuring that all areas meet health and safety standards. They play a critical role in infection control, especially in healthcare settings, by preventing the spread of germs and contaminants. Environmental Services Assistants work closely with other staff to provide a clean and welcoming environment for patients, visitors, and employees.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an environmental services ass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Environmental Services Assistant, you need a solid understanding of cleaning protocols, infection control, and safety procedures,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with cleaning equipment, chemical handling, and safety data sheets (SDS) is typically required. Strong attention to detail, reliability, and effective communication are standout soft skills in this role. These skills are crucial to maintaining a safe, sanitary, and welcoming environment in healthcare and institutional settings.

What are some common challenges faced by environmental services assistants and how are they addressed?

Environmental Services Assistants often encounter challenges such as maintaining high cleanliness standards in fast-paced environments, handling hazardous materials safely, and adapting to shifting schedules or urgent requests. These challenges are typically addressed through comprehensive training, clear protocols, and support from supervisors and team members. Open communication and teamwork play a vital role in ensuring tasks are completed efficiently and safely, fostering a positive and collaborative work environment.

What is the difference between Environmental Services Assistant vs Housekeeping Aide?

AspectEnvironmental Services AssistantHousekeeping Aide
CertificationsMay require OSHA training, safety certificationsTypically no formal certifications needed
Work EnvironmentHospitals, clinics, healthcare facilitiesHotels, residential facilities, healthcare settings
Job DutiesCleaning, disinfecting, waste management, equipment sanitationCleaning rooms, making beds, laundry, general cleaning
Employer & Industry UsageHealthcare industry, hospitalsHospitality, healthcare, residential

Environmental Services Assistants focus on maintaining cleanliness and sanitation in healthcare settings, often requiring safety certifications. Housekeeping Aides primarily work in hospitality or residential environments, with duties centered on cleaning and guest comfort. While both roles involve cleaning tasks, their work environments and specific responsibilities differ significantly.

Job description

Attention all Dental Assistants, we are calling on you to partner with us to complete dental exams, treatment, and X-rays to our Military Service members.
We will primarily work weekends, with some occasional weekdays in the State of Puerto Rico on an "as needed basis".
We provide health readiness services to meet the medical and dental requirements to maintain a deployable military force for the following:
  • U.S. Army Reserve (USAR)
  • Army National Guard (ARNG)
  • U.S. Navy Reserve (USNR)
  • U.S. Marine Forces Reserve (MARFORRES)
  • U.S. Coast Guard Reserve (USCGR)
  • Air National Guard (ANG)
  • U.S. Air Force Reserve (USAFR)

Responsibilities:
  • Provide dental services in a mobile environment.
  • Provide Digital x-Rays (BW & PANO).
  • Provide sterilization of instruments.

Requirements
  • Active Dental Assistant Certification in the state (CDA, RDA, EDDA, EFDA)
  • Active Radiology Certification
  • CPR/BLS Certification
  • Comfortable with 4-handed chair-side assisting
  • Experience with sterilization
  • Experience with basic administrative functions
  • Experience working with military - preferred
  • Proficient with computer programs
  • Must have weekend availability
